Design features of the body and platform
In 2016 Octavia based on platform MQBIt has changed the way we build and weight the car. The use of high-strength steels has reduced the total weight, which directly affected fuel efficiency. The body has excellent galvanizing, which is critical for regions with aggressive reagents on the roads.
The style of the car remains restrained and functional. The front part received an updated grille and optics, but in 2016 it did not have the changes that appeared after the full facelift of 2017. You will notice the brand-specific lines and angular shapes that give the car a strict look.
It is important to note the quality of the panel assembly. The gaps between the body elements in the 2016 copies are usually uniform, and the paint coating is quite resistant to small stones. However, during the inspection, pay attention to the joints of the wings and doors, as there may be traces of poor-quality repairs after an accident.
⚠️ Attention: Pay special attention to the condition of the rapids and arches. In 2016, some batches had problems with insufficient protection in the lower parts of the body, which could lead to corrosion in the absence of regular washing and treatment with anti-gravel compounds.
The luggage compartment remains the main trump card of the model. In the version of Liftback volume is an impressive 590 liters, and in the hatchback – 568 liters. This space allows you to load large items without having to fold the rear seats. The space under the floor is also spacious, there you can place a spare wheel and a set of tools.
Engines: Gasoline, Diesel and their features
The line of power units for 2016 is represented by a wide range of options. The most popular choice was gasoline. 1.6 MPI 110 hp. This atmospheric engine is distinguished by reliability and unpretentiousness to fuel quality, which makes it ideal for urban operation and taxi fleets.
For those who appreciate the dynamics, the series turbo engines were offered TSI volume of 1.2 liters (105 hp) and 1.4 liters (125 hp). The 1.4 TSI engine is a more modern solution, providing excellent traction at low revs thanks to the direct injection system. However, it is more demanding on the maintenance and quality of the oil.
Diesel version 2.0 TDI It attracts drivers with its efficiency and high torque. These engines are able to go more than 300 000 kilometers without major repairs, provided timely replacement of the fuel and the use of high-quality diesel. In Russia, they are less popular due to the difficulties with the maintenance of the AdBlue system and particulate filter.
- ✅ 1.6 MPI It is ideal for a quiet ride and high mileage without a turbine.
- ✅ 1.4 TSI Better balance between power and fuel consumption.
- ✅ 2.0 TDI A choice for those who drive a lot on the track and love the dynamics.
It should be remembered that turbocharged engines require more frequent oil replacement than atmospheric counterparts. The interval of 15,000 km, declared by the manufacturer, on our roads it is better to reduce to 7000-8000 km. This will extend the life of the turbine and piston group.

Transmission: Gearbox Variations
The choice of transmission in 2016 directly affects comfort and reliability. For 1.6 MPI engines, 5-speed mechanics or 6-speed automatic were most often offered. Aisin. The latter is a benchmark of reliability and is able to withstand a huge mileage without serious intervention.
With turbocharged motors installed robotic boxes DSG. It is important to distinguish between two types: DQ200 (dry clutch, 7 steps) and DQ250 (wet clutch, 6 steps). The DQ200, which is mounted on the 1.2 and 1.4 TSI, had known problems with the mechatronics and clutch basket in early versions.
The DQ250, paired with more powerful engines, is considered more durable due to the use of oil in the clutch system. However, it also requires regular replacement of the transmission fluid every 60,000 km. Ignoring this rule can lead to costly repairs.
⚠️ Note: When testing with a DSG box, pay attention to the jerks when switching at low speeds (1-2-3 gears). This may indicate clutch wear or mechatronic problems that are expensive to repair.
- 🛠 Mechanics Cheap to repair, but requires driving skills in traffic.
- 🛠 Automatic Aisin The most reliable, but a little slow in switching.
- 🛠 DSG 7 (dry) Fast, but requires careful maintenance.
The Aisin 1.6 MPI is the most reliable option for mileage purchase, eliminating the risks of expensive repairs of robotic transmissions.
Technical nuances and typical problems
Despite the overall reliability, Octavia 2016 has a number of specific sores, which every potential buyer should know about. One of the frequent problems is the failure of mechatronics in DSG boxes, especially when driving aggressively or overheating. Replacing this unit can cost a substantial amount.
In the cooling system, you should pay attention to the plastic expansion tank and the thermostat. Over time, the plastic becomes brittle and can crack and the thermostat jams, which will lead to overheating of the engine. There are also cases of heater leaks, which require removal of the dashboard to replace.
The electric car is also not without disadvantages. Sometimes parking sensors fail or windows stop working correctly. In winter, door locks can freeze if moisture gets into them, so regular treatment with silicone lubrication is mandatory.

What is mechatronics and why does it break?
Mechatronics is a transmission control unit that combines hydraulics and electronics. It breaks down due to overheating, dirty oil and wear of solenoids. Replacement often requires reflashing.
The suspension of the car is quite comfortable, but energy-consuming. The front stabilizer racks and the Silent lever blocks may require replacement by 60,000-80,000 km. Shock absorbers last longer, usually around 100,000 km, but their condition is highly dependent on the quality of roads.
| Knot | Resource (km) | Symptoms of wear |
|---|---|---|
| Timing belt | 120 000 | Noise, vibration, risk of cliffs |
| DSG clutch | 100 000 | Squeak, squeak, delays. |
| Thermostat | 80 000 | Overheating, long warm-up |
| Coolant pump | 60 000 | Antifreeze leak, noise |
⚠️ Never buy a car with a mileage of more than 150,000 km without a complete service history. The lack of oil replacement records in the engine and gearbox is a serious signal of hidden problems.
Electronics and multimedia
Interior Octavia 2016 is made in a strict style with high-quality materials. Multimedia system can be presented in different versions: from simple radio to a system. Swing or Amundsen with navigation. The screens have good resolution, but the interface may seem outdated compared to modern smartphones.
A common problem is the head unit hovering or loss of Bluetooth connectivity. In some cases, it helps to reset settings or update software through a dealership. It is also worth checking the performance of the rear view camera, as the lenses are often contaminated or fail due to temperature changes.
The climate control works efficiently, but requires a cabin filter to be replaced every 10,000 km. Otherwise, the system may start to make extraneous sounds, and the cooling efficiency will decrease. In expensive trim levels, dual-zone climate control is available, which allows you to adjust the temperature for the driver and passenger separately.
Before buying, be sure to check the operation of all the buttons on the steering wheel and center console. Sticking media control buttons is a common problem that requires replacing the entire button block.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ions
What is the most reliable engine for the 2016 Octavia?
The most reliable is the atmospheric gasoline engine 1.6 MPI. It is simple in design, has no turbine and direct injection, which reduces the risk of expensive breakdowns. The 2.0 TDI diesel is also reliable, but requires quality fuel.
Should you buy an Octavia with a DSG 7 (dry clutch) box?
Buying is possible, but with caution. The DQ200 has known problems with mechatronics and clutch. If you decide to make such a purchase, be sure to check the service history and availability of fresh oil changes in the box. It is better to consider the option with the Aisin machine.
What is the real fuel consumption of the 2016 Octavia?
In the urban cycle, fuel consumption is 8-10 liters per 100 km for gasoline versions and 5-6 liters for diesel ones. On the track, the numbers are reduced to 5-6 liters for gasoline and 4-5 liters for diesel. The actual consumption depends on the driving style and operating conditions.
Does the electronics in this model often break down?
The electronics are generally reliable, but there may be problems with parking sensors, windows and a multimedia system. These breakdowns are usually not critical and are solved by replacing specific nodes, but can cause inconvenience.
How often should the timing belt be changed?
The manufacturer recommends changing the belt every 120,000 km or every 5 years. However, in practice, especially in the Russian climate, it is better to check the condition of the belt every 60,000 km and change it at the first sign of wear.
